Long-term survival of patients with stage III colon cancer treated with VRP-CEA(6D), an alphavirus vector that increases the CD8+ effector memory T cell to Treg ratio.

Erika J CrosbyAmy C HobeikaDonna NiedzwieckiChristel RushingDavid HsuPeter BerglundJonathan SmithTakuya OsadaWilliam R Gwin IiiZachary Conrad HartmanMichael A MorseHerbert Kim Lyerly
Published in: Journal for immunotherapy of cancer (2021)
VRP-CEA induces antigen-specific effector T cells while decreasing Tregs, suggesting favorable immune modulation. Long-term survivors were identified in both cohorts, suggesting the OS may be prolonged.
